Life was never really hard for Hiwalani-Noa. She was never without affection and attention even though she was one of fourteen children, being part of a set of quadruplets herself. With eight brothers and five sisters among many cousins, she always had someone to play with. Her parents were undeniably the most “go with the flow” people in Lahaina. Especially for parents with so many children as well as businesses to run. It wasn't uncommon to see one of Ailani and Mano-Akeakamai's offspring roaming the beaches and streets and businesses of the city. While it was a large place, all of the natives knew a Kealoha when they saw one and they knew better than to mess with one of the young ones. Most of them were spending time with their grandpa Kona at the beach anyways. With more brothers than sisters and being very much a daddy's girl, she was no stranger to speaking her mind and often got in trouble with other people for it, though her father often found it amusing and would pat her on the back for being so brash. She was always the most adventurous of her siblings and would often get in trouble along with her brothers for going out into the jungle to explore without an adult accompanying them. Unlike their other family members, Hiwalani-Noa and her siblings weren't really exposed to the Haole as much as everyone else. Probably because they were too busy evading home for adventures. Hiwalani-Noa especially avoided them (and most others) when she turned seven and began sprouting a tail in the water. She had begun wrapping her legs in cellophane and wearing a wetsuit when she went swimming or surfing to avoid discovery. The measures she went through to keep dry legs while swimming were unbelievable. She was fifteen when she deemed school useless and dropped out. Though, it had a lot to do with one of her elder brothers -- Keokolo. The two of them were undeniably the most popular kids in all of Lahaina and everybody wanted to be around them. However, Keokolo had built up a reputation as a promiscuous young man and because the two were so close and so popular, it wasn't long before everyone assumed that she was just as easy as he was. Less and less of her peers spent time with her just for the sake of friendship and more for the hope of getting into her bed. She didn't blame Keokolo for this and didn't care how he lead his life as long as he was happy. However, when he asserted himself in the "big brother" role to keep these suitors at bay, it soon became a bit more than she could handle. He didn't trust anyone around his little sister and assumed they were all after the same thing, ridding her of nearly all males in her life that weren't related. But that wasn't his crime. His crime was bedding more than half of her female friends. She had enough when she had slumber party for her fifteenth birthday and a fight broke out between the other four girls over Keokolo, effectively ruining her night. Her parents let her leave Hawaii with her oldest sister, Lilo, and her indie band to accompany her on gigs and vacations during the summer so long as she spent the normal school year working at the studio and the restaurant. This further distanced her from Keokolo, though the rest of the family's bond with her didn't seem to slack at all. This summer, however, Lilo decided to stay home. Noa is certainly old enough to venture out on her own and had planned a trip to Greece. But her parents decided that she and Keokolo had been fighting for long enough and forced her to remain home and repair their bond as well as help with the threat of the most tourists Lahaina has seen in years, as it has been targeted as destination number one for a mass of college fraternities and sororities from the mainland.
